Solution for 3i-13=2i+9 equation:


Simplifying
3i + -13 = 2i + 9

Reorder the terms:
-13 + 3i = 2i + 9

Reorder the terms:
-13 + 3i = 9 + 2i

Solving
-13 + 3i = 9 + 2i

Solving for variable 'i'.

Move all terms containing i to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2i' to each side of the equation.
-13 + 3i + -2i = 9 + 2i + -2i

Combine like terms: 3i + -2i = 1i
-13 + 1i = 9 + 2i + -2i

Combine like terms: 2i + -2i = 0
-13 + 1i = 9 + 0
-13 + 1i = 9

Add '13' to each side of the equation.
-13 + 13 + 1i = 9 + 13

Combine like terms: -13 + 13 = 0
0 + 1i = 9 + 13
1i = 9 + 13

Combine like terms: 9 + 13 = 22
1i = 22

Divide each side by '1'.
i = 22

Simplifying
i = 22
